Overview

WiSC Enterprises is seeking a highly skilled Senior Acquisition Specialist and Governance Analyst to lead and support full lifecycle acquisition activities and program oversight. This role supports acquisition planning, compliance reviews, workflow development, stakeholder engagement, and lifecycle contract administration. The ideal candidate has extensive experience in procurement strategy, policy documentation, stakeholder coordination, and acquisition governance support in highly regulated environments.

Responsibilities

  • Lead and support acquisition governance activities, including acquisition working groups, contract review boards, and strategic documentation preparation.
  • Manage acquisition lifecycle activities from requirements development to contract closeout, ensuring compliance with legal and organizational standards.
  • Develop and maintain acquisition documents such as Statements of Work (SOWs), Performance Work Statements (PWS), Independent Government Cost Estimates (IGCEs), Determinations & Findings (D&Fs), and Justifications & Approvals (J&As).
  • Coordinate and facilitate board meetings, distribute read-ahead materials, track attendance, document decisions, and follow up on action items.
  • Partner with program and contracting teams to ensure accurate procurement documentation and lifecycle tracking for contracts exceeding $30M.
  • Analyze market research, pricing data, and contract proposals to evaluate technical, financial, and performance feasibility.
  • Train and support PMO and stakeholders on acquisition board processes, document preparation, and compliance.
  • Maintain acquisition records and historical files, both electronically and in hard copy formats, for internal and audit use.
  • TS/SCI with POLY is required to start


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Contract Management, or related field.
  • 10+ years of experience supporting government acquisitions, contract management, or procurement operations.
  • In-depth knowledge of the full acquisition lifecycle and federal acquisition regulations (FAR/DFARS).
  • Proven ability to manage complex acquisition portfolios and coordinate with contracting officers, CORs, and technical stakeholders.
  • Strong writing, documentation, and communication skills.


Desired Qualifications

  • Experience with contract writing and tracking systems (e.g., PRISM, PIEE, WAWF).
  • Familiarity with government procurement tools and systems (e.g., SAM.gov, GSA eBuy).
  • Certification in contract management or project management (e.g., FAC-C, DAWIA, PMP).
  • Experience developing SOPs, acquisition policy documents, and performance reports.
